ROBOTICS & CODING

 

In this course, your child will focus on either an engineering-oriented or coding-oriented experience, and collaborate with a team consisting of engineers and coders to apply learned skills in order to design, create, code, and test their very own robot. 

If your kid chooses to specialize in coding they will collaborate in a team to program a robot, along the way learning the fundamentals of the Python programming language, from coding on-device programs, to utilizing code in interactive machines. They will then collaborate with the engineers to get their own robot through a series of obstacles, improving on the initial code in order to complete more challenges than rival teams.

If your kid chooses to specialize in engineering, they will collaborate in a team to design a robot, along the way learning to design both the robot’s circuits using a microcontroller, resistors, motors and cables, and the robot itself, based on recycled materials. They will then collaborate with the programmers to get the robot through a series of obstacles, improving on the initial design in order to complete more challenges than rival teams.

Schedule:

Week 1: Circuit Basics & Robot Brainstorming

Week 2: Robot Physical & Electrical Design

Week 3: Robot Building(Part 1) & Coding Intro

Week 4: Robot Building(Part 2) & Coding Robot

Week 5: Catchup Day & Competition 1

Week 6: Robot Iterations & Competitions 

Week 7: Competitions Wrap Up & Reflections

Week 8: Course Wrap Up & Reflections

GRAPHIC DESIGN

This course will teach students the essential skills needed to grow their graphic design skills. We will set their foundational knowledge with practice in using the elements of art and the principles of design. Practical skills will include knowledge in professional tools like Adobe Photoshop, Adobe InDesign, and Adobe Illustrator. Projects will simulate real-world applications of graphic design, including advertisement, product design, and illustration. We will also teach productive workflows to students to create successful designs, from making thumbnail sketches, to handling rounds of feedback. There will be a focus on student choice, as to not limit students’ creativity as they establish their own style.

Schedule:

Week 1: Create Company concept and design a logo

Week 2: Finish Logos. Next, choose and create a detailed piece of advertisement for your company concept(ex: t-shirt design, poster, mascot character design, etc).

Week 3: Work on detailed ad.

Week 4: Continue work on detailed ad. Next, choose and create an interactive advertisement for your company concept (ex: video, animation, packaging, webpage, etc).

Week 5: Work on interactive ad.

Week 6: Continue work on interactive ad. Next, create and design a portfolio showcasing your work.

Week 7: Work on Portfolio.

Week 8: Presentation Time

Game Design

Have an enriching experience by learning how to make fun games on the Unity Game Engine! You will be learning the C# programming language and creating a 2-dimensional platforming simulator video game!

Schedule:

Week 1: Learn the basics in C# and the Unity Game Engine

Week 2: Importing and interacting with sprites in Unity Game Engine

Week 3: Animations

Week 4: Using Colliders and Triggers

Week 5: Adding basic Artificial Intelligence

Week 6: Familiarizing yourself with  the User Interface

Week 7: Upgrade and Point system

Week 8: Playtesting
